A handful of houses, including a unit with ocean views, are set to go to unpaid rates auction by Livingstone Shire Council later this month.
A formal notice was published by the council on March 13 for four properties with unpaid rates.
Under Local Government Regulation 2012, council is authorised to sell land if the rates or charges have been overdue for at least three years, or one year for vacant or commercial land.
The land is to be sold at market or land value or higher than the amount of the overdue rates/charges.
A list of 18 properties for auction were presented to council on September 20, 2022, and a number of owners have since paid the outstanding amounts.
The remaining property owners were sent a Notice of Intention to Sell on November 7 and the auction will proceed unless all overdue rates, interest and other amounts are paid.
“Ratepayers always have the options to enter into formal payment arrangements which prevents legal action being progressed by council’s debt collection agency,” a council report starts.
Council charges a rate of seven per cent per annum on overdue rates and utility charges, applied monthly on all overdue balances.
As of February 2023, 424 properties were under management totalling a sum of $1,701,841 with 269 under debt collection, 52 under proposals to pay, 101 under agreements to pay and two under council hardship.
Livingstone Shire Council has 18,098 rateable properties with 424 under management representing 2.3 per cent.
UNPAID RATES PROPERTIES TO GO TO AUCTION:
- 180-186 Barmoya Road, The Caves. Rural residential lot of 6343 sq m with house. Last sold in 2002 for $158,000.
- 105 Dempsey Street, Ogmore Rural lot of 1430 sq m with house. Last sold in 2004 for $25,000.
- 204 Stones Road, Woodbury Rural 10 hectare lot with house and pool. Last sold in 1990 for $90,000.
- Unit 46, 4-8 Adelaide Street, Yeppoon. One-bedroom, one-bathroom unit at Bayview Tower. Last sold in 2017 for $120,000.
The public auction will be held at 10am on March 28 at the HUB on James Street.
Licensed auctioneer and Ray White Yeppoon principal Lindsay Lodwick will host the auction.
Successful buyers will need to pay a 10 per cent deposit of the total price on the day.
